How does PayPal provide accessible services to people with access needs?

We work hard to make sure that our service is accessible to everyone. We do this in various ways.

  • We make links on our website descriptive and provide alternative text to help people using assistive technology such as screen reader software.
  • We consider accessibility when we design features or pages.
  • We increase the contrast between fonts and backgrounds to make text easier to read.
  • We make our website easier to navigate when using only a keyboard.
  • We ensure there is logical focus order and focus indicators for interactive elements.

Keyboard Navigation

You can use a keyboard to navigate through PayPal. Here are the common keyboard controls:

  • Tab: To move forward through interactive elements (links, buttons, menus)
  • Shift + Tab: To move backward through interactive elements
  • Space: To activate links
  • Enter: To activate buttons or links
